The Classique au Vert Festival is back in action from June 24 to September 6, 2026, in the heart of the Parc Floral de Paris. This year again, Classique au Vert invites music lovers and newcomers alike to keep a lively tempo and soak up the sun with a lineup of acclaimed artists and rising talents.

This year, Classique au Vert makes its return to Paris from June 24 to September 6, 2026. Spanning chamber to orchestral music, instrumental to vocal works, from solo recitals to quartets, and even exploring touches of jazz and world music... there’s truly something for every taste.

Through a new series of free concerts, Classique au vert transforms thus the Parc Floral de Paris into a true summer garden dedicated to the classical music. With family or friends, it's the perfect chance to enjoy music in the heart of one of Paris's most beautiful parks!

This summer's lineup promises to be as rich and uplifting as ever, featuring cellist Astrig Siranossian and pianist Nathanaël Gouin, trumpeter Lucienne Renaudin Vary and accordionist Félicien Brut, harpsichordist Justin Taylor, as well as Ensemble Diderot, founded by violinist Johannes Pramsohler, the Swedish-Norwegian string quartet Opus13, pianist Vanessa Wagner, not forgetting the Orchestre de Chambre de Paris conducted by Karel Deseure with soloist Eva Zavaro.

Classical in the Green: the 2026 lineup, day by day

  • Saturday, June 27, 2026 – 4:00 PM
    • I Giardini & Pierre Fouchenneret

  • Sunday, July 5, 2026 – 4:00 PM
    • Astrig Siranossian and Nathanael Goin – Romantic Poetry

  • Saturday, July 11, 2026 – 4:00 PM
    • Lucienne Renaudin Vary & Felicien Brut – The Perfect Match

  • Sunday, July 19, 2026 – 4:00 PM
    • Salome Gasselin and Justin Taylor – Pastoral Celebration

  • Sunday, August 16, 2026 – 4:00 PM
    • Ensemble Diderot / Johannes Pramsohler

  • Saturday, August 22, 2026 – 4:00 PM
    • Opus13 String Quartet

  • Sunday, August 30, 2026 – 4:00 PM
    • Vanessa Wagner – Homage to Philip Glass

  • Saturday, September 5, 2026 – 4:00 PM
    • Orchestre de Chambre de Paris

 

We’d like to remind you that these daytime concerts are free and open to everyone, with no reservations required. Only the entrance to the Parc Floral is paid. And don’t forget that the Parc Floral also hosts two other summer festivals, namely Pestacles and the Paris Jazz Festival.
